Home
last modified time | relevance | path

Searched refs:intrs (Results 1 – 25 of 26) sorted by relevance

12

/freebsd/sys/dev/dpaa/
H A Dbman_portals.c208 uint32_t intrs; in bman_portal_isr() local
210 intrs = bm_ci_read(sc, BCSP_ISR); in bman_portal_isr()
213 if (intrs & INTR_RCRI) { in bman_portal_isr()
217 if (intrs & INTR_BSCN) { in bman_portal_isr()
229 bm_ci_write(sc, BCSP_ISR, intrs); in bman_portal_isr()
/freebsd/usr.sbin/bhyve/riscv/
H A Dpci_irq.c36 pci_irq_init(int intrs[static 4]) in pci_irq_init()
41 aplic_irqs[i] = intrs[i]; in pci_irq_init()
H A Dpci_irq_machdep.h35 void pci_irq_init(int intrs[static 4]);
H A Dfdt.h41 void fdt_add_pcie(int intrs[static 4]);
H A Dfdt.c247 fdt_add_pcie(int intrs[static 4]) in fdt_add_pcie()
314 intr = intrs[(pin + slot) % 4]; in fdt_add_pcie()
/freebsd/sys/dev/bhnd/bcma/
H A Dbcma_subr.c310 STAILQ_INSERT_HEAD(&dinfo->intrs, intr, i_link); in bcma_dinfo_init_intrs()
336 STAILQ_INIT(&dinfo->intrs); in bcma_alloc_dinfo()
387 STAILQ_FOREACH(intr, &dinfo->intrs, i_link) { in bcma_init_dinfo()
440 STAILQ_FOREACH_SAFE(intr, &dinfo->intrs, i_link, inext) { in bcma_free_dinfo()
441 STAILQ_REMOVE(&dinfo->intrs, intr, bcma_intr, i_link); in bcma_free_dinfo()
H A Dbcmavar.h185 struct bcma_intr_list intrs; /**< interrupt descriptors */ member
H A Dbcma.c636 STAILQ_FOREACH(desc, &dinfo->intrs, i_link) { in bcma_get_intr_ivec()
/freebsd/sys/contrib/dev/rtw89/
H A Dpci.c786 isrs->isrs[0] = rtw89_read32(rtwdev, R_AX_PCIE_HISR00) & rtwpci->intrs[0]; in rtw89_pci_recognize_intrs()
787 isrs->isrs[1] = rtw89_read32(rtwdev, R_AX_PCIE_HISR10) & rtwpci->intrs[1]; in rtw89_pci_recognize_intrs()
803 rtw89_read32(rtwdev, R_AX_HAXI_HISR00) & rtwpci->intrs[0] : 0; in rtw89_pci_recognize_intrs_v1()
805 rtw89_read32(rtwdev, R_AX_HISR1) & rtwpci->intrs[1] : 0; in rtw89_pci_recognize_intrs_v1()
824 rtw89_read32(rtwdev, R_BE_HAXI_HISR00) & rtwpci->intrs[0] : 0; in rtw89_pci_recognize_intrs_v2()
825 isrs->isrs[1] = rtw89_read32(rtwdev, R_BE_PCIE_DMA_ISR) & rtwpci->intrs[1]; in rtw89_pci_recognize_intrs_v2()
844 isrs->isrs[1] = rtw89_read32(rtwdev, R_BE_PCIE_DMA_ISR) & rtwpci->intrs[1]; in rtw89_pci_recognize_intrs_v3()
863 rtw89_write32(rtwdev, R_AX_PCIE_HIMR00, rtwpci->intrs[0]); in rtw89_pci_enable_intr()
864 rtw89_write32(rtwdev, R_AX_PCIE_HIMR10, rtwpci->intrs[1]); in rtw89_pci_enable_intr()
880 rtw89_write32(rtwdev, R_AX_HAXI_HIMR00, rtwpci->intrs[0]); in rtw89_pci_enable_intr_v1()
[all …]
/freebsd/sys/contrib/openzfs/module/os/linux/spl/
H A Dspl-kstat.c191 kip->intrs[KSTAT_INTR_HARD], in kstat_seq_show_intr()
192 kip->intrs[KSTAT_INTR_SOFT], in kstat_seq_show_intr()
193 kip->intrs[KSTAT_INTR_WATCHDOG], in kstat_seq_show_intr()
194 kip->intrs[KSTAT_INTR_SPURIOUS], in kstat_seq_show_intr()
195 kip->intrs[KSTAT_INTR_MULTSVC]); in kstat_seq_show_intr()
/freebsd/sys/dev/oce/
H A Doce_if.c822 ii = &sc->intrs[vector]; in oce_alloc_intr()
869 if (sc->intrs[i].tag != NULL) in oce_intr_free()
870 bus_teardown_intr(sc->dev, sc->intrs[i].intr_res, in oce_intr_free()
871 sc->intrs[i].tag); in oce_intr_free()
872 if (sc->intrs[i].tq != NULL) in oce_intr_free()
873 taskqueue_free(sc->intrs[i].tq); in oce_intr_free()
875 if (sc->intrs[i].intr_res != NULL) in oce_intr_free()
877 sc->intrs[i].irq_rr, in oce_intr_free()
878 sc->intrs[i].intr_res); in oce_intr_free()
879 sc->intrs[ in oce_intr_free()
[all...]
H A Doce_if.h816 OCE_INTR_INFO intrs[OCE_MAX_EQ]; member
H A Doce_queue.c585 sc->intrs[sc->neqs++].eq = eq; in oce_eq_create()
/freebsd/usr.sbin/bhyve/aarch64/
H A Dfdt.c307 fdt_add_pcie(int intrs[static 4]) in fdt_add_pcie()
372 intr = intrs[(pin + slot) % 4]; in fdt_add_pcie()
/freebsd/sys/dev/ste/
H A Dif_ste.c508 uint16_t intrs, status; in ste_intr() local
527 intrs = STE_INTRS; in ste_intr()
528 if (status == 0xFFFF || (status & intrs) == 0) in ste_intr()
533 intrs &= ~STE_IMR_RX_DMADONE; in ste_intr()
554 intrs &= ~STE_IMR_RX_DMADONE; in ste_intr()
557 intrs |= STE_IMR_RX_DMADONE; in ste_intr()
579 CSR_WRITE_2(sc, STE_IMR, intrs); in ste_intr()
/freebsd/sys/x86/iommu/
H A Dx86_iommu.h168 struct iommu_msi_data intrs[IOMMU_MAX_MSI]; member
H A Dintel_drv.c306 dmd = &unit->x86c.intrs[i]; in dmar_remap_intr()
399 unit->x86c.intrs[i].irq = -1; in dmar_attach()
401 dmd = &unit->x86c.intrs[DMAR_INTR_FAULT]; in dmar_attach()
421 dmd = &unit->x86c.intrs[DMAR_INTR_QI]; in dmar_attach()
H A Diommu_utils.c576 dmd = &IOMMU2X86C(unit)->intrs[idx]; in iommu_alloc_irq()
640 dmd = &IOMMU2X86C(unit)->intrs[idx]; in iommu_release_intr()
/freebsd/sys/contrib/openzfs/include/os/linux/spl/sys/
H A Dkstat.h168 uint_t intrs[KSTAT_NUM_INTRS]; member
/freebsd/sys/contrib/openzfs/include/os/freebsd/spl/sys/
H A Dkstat.h166 uint_t intrs[KSTAT_NUM_INTRS]; member
/freebsd/sys/dev/netmap/
H A Dif_ptnet.c113 uint64_t intrs; member
1065 (cur.intrs - pq->last_stats.intrs)); in ptnet_tick()
1285 pq->stats.intrs ++; in ptnet_tx_intr()
1308 pq->stats.intrs ++; in ptnet_rx_intr()
/freebsd/sys/dev/bwi/
H A Dbwimac.c380 uint32_t intrs; in bwi_mac_init() local
383 intrs = BWI_TXRX_RX_INTRS; in bwi_mac_init()
385 intrs = BWI_TXRX_TX_INTRS; in bwi_mac_init()
386 CSR_WRITE_4(sc, BWI_TXRX_INTR_MASK(i), intrs); in bwi_mac_init()
/freebsd/sys/dev/re/
H A Dif_re.c2652 uint16_t intrs, status; in re_intr_msi() local
2671 intrs = RL_INTRS_CPLUS; in re_intr_msi()
2675 intrs &= ~(RL_ISR_RX_OK | RL_ISR_RX_ERR | RL_ISR_FIFO_OFLOW | in re_intr_msi()
2690 intrs &= ~(RL_ISR_RX_OK | RL_ISR_RX_ERR | in re_intr_msi()
2694 intrs |= RL_ISR_RX_OK | RL_ISR_RX_ERR | in re_intr_msi()
2723 CSR_WRITE_2(sc, RL_IMR, intrs); in re_intr_msi()
/freebsd/sys/x86/x86/
H A Dintr_machdep.c713 SYSCTL_PROC(_hw, OID_AUTO, intrs,
/freebsd/sys/dev/ti/
H A Dif_ti.c1959 uint32_t intrs; in ti_setmulti() local
1973 intrs = CSR_READ_4(sc, TI_MB_HOSTINTR); in ti_setmulti()
1983 CSR_WRITE_4(sc, TI_MB_HOSTINTR, intrs); in ti_setmulti()

12